Q. Check ferrite content of austenitic stainless steel weld?

Check the ferrite content of each austenitic stainless steel weld, including overlay welds, in the as-welded condition using a Severn gauge or a Feritscope. The ferrite shall be between three and ten percent (3-10 FN).

Ferrite number shall be determined over the complete range of applicable welding parameters specified in the WPS.

Ferrite test shall be performed on all austenitic stainless steel.

Frequency of testing shall be as follows:

• For overlaid components two tests shall be made on each component.

• For clad restoration one test shall be made for each 3.05 m (10 ft) length.

X-ray fluorescent analyzer or wet analysis methods shall be used to verify chemistry of components and welds.

Testing shall be performed to recognized standards by an approved testing agency or laboratory.

Magnetic instrument used to measure the delta ferrite content of austenitic stainless steel weld metal shall be calibrated per AWS A 4.2, latest edition.

Type 310 welds are exempt form this requirement.
